STEM Ambassador Profile

Name: Peter Nevin

Organisation: Retired Consulting Engineer

Job Title: The Engineer, Project Manager, etc.

Area of work or study

The Engineer and previously Senior Project Manager, for Power Plant,Incinerators, fueled by Coal,Oil,Nuclear,Gas and associated De salination,Local serices of Town and Rail links.

How did you decide to work in your chosen field?

It chose me as I was told that not many people could Engineer plant and also knew the Financial risks, Estimated Costs, Project/Contract Knowledge and sustainability of Pay back.

Educational Path

Grammer School, Apprenticeship,Higher National plus Endorsements, Design and Technical Estimates of Large Power Projects.Astronomy and M.O.D work.University was not general in 1950's nor Day Release mine was three nights and Saturday morning.

What attracted you to the STEM Ambassadors scheme?

I was a I.Mech.E. Ambassidor for Schools on the Nineties to present day.

What do you like about being a STEM Ambassador?

Trying to encourage students into Science and Engineering built on this countries leading knowledge.

What do you see as the benefits of the STEM Ambassadors scheme?

I saw reuslts in Students who researched Photo Voltaic Cells in 1997/8 under my guidance for their personel input and idea. look where it is now as they forescast it. They went on to University.

STEM Ambassadors activities

Scientific Managment, Design of Bridges using their Elbows and Arms to demonstrate equal and opposite forces of Tyne and Sydney Harbour Bridge.Assembling Plastic tube and Velcro to prove it.

caught them almost asleep on their arms and hands and said you have already proved this possible.

What was the reaction of the young people you worked with?

F W Taylor's approach would help them in future, great designs are often everday in their view if they thought about it. Education is to fit you for work and life not necessarily what you would enjoy as a hobby.

What advice would you give to young people wanting to work in your field?

To thine own self be true (Shakespear), If you have nothing to do don't do it here. The Seat of learning has know end( U.M.I.S.T.).I am 77 next month and still learning.
